      Marc Pingris has had a sudden change of heart, saying that he now wants to join the Gilas Pilipinas pool “if the Philippine team still needs me” in a statement released Wednesday by his mother team San Miguel Purefoods, one of three companies in the powerhouse San Miguel Corporation conglomerate in the Philippine Basketball Association.


      Need more proof???

      Other big names who are not in the pool are Paul Lee and Jeff Chan of Rain or Shine and Marcio Lassiter of San Miguel Beer.
      Controversies
      The Inquirer spoke to one of the noted absentees, who asked that he not be identified for fear of being traded away by his team.
      “After all of these controversies that are happening, I sincerely hope that something good happens, and that is for Gilas to win,” said the player, who was with the Gilas Pilipinas team that won the Jones Cup and was also a mainstay of the 2013 Fiba Asia squad.
      “It just pains me to be reading all the things they are saying about me, and it makes me doubly guilty because I don’t like the decision (of not joining the pool this time) I made of begging off,” he said.
      READ: Gilas window slowly closing except for June Mar Fajardo
      Another said that it was a pity that the team owners in the PBA couldn’t get together as they should for national cause, citing the solid opportunity that the country has to get back in the Olympics next year.
      “I honestly believe that if this team had the same components of the team that played in Spain, we would be very hard to beat,” said the other player. “But of course, it’s out of our hands. We players do what we’re told to do.
      Negative effect
      A third former Gilas mainstay said that Pingris’ decision could have a negative effect on the other players in the pool, noting that: “you know how basketball players think.”
      He said that, after begging off, he has totally abandoned all hopes of being able to join the squad not only because his team did not grant him the release, but he believes that it is too late in the day for him and all the others to do so.
      READ: Gilas Pilipinas starts 2015 Fiba Asia campaign vs Palestine
      “They have been in training for what, two weeks-plus?” he asked. “The bad thing about it is that some of the other players who were there from Day 1 might think that we are sacred cows.”
      “I just envy (those who were able to join the pool). Sayang, malakas sana ang team (It’s a pity because the team is strong) with Andray (Blatche, Gilas’ naturalized player) being more familiar with the team now. But life must go on for all of us.”
      The Inquirer also asked Gilas team manager Butch Antonio to comment on Pingris’ change of heart, but Antonio has yet to reply.
